George Burns - IMDb
Burns had his greatest film success playing God in the comedy film "Oh, God!" (1977). The film 51 million dollars at the domestic box office, and was one of the greatest hits of 1977.
Oh, God! Book II (1980) - IMDb
Oh, God! Book II: Directed by Gilbert Cates. With George Burns, Suzanne Pleshette, David Birney, Louanne. A young girl receives a divine message and starts a campaign to promote faith. Her family and teacher, skeptical of her claims, try to stop her efforts. She persists despite their opposition, convinced of her heavenly calling.
Oh, God! You Devil (1984) - IMDb
Oh, God! You Devil: Directed by Paul Bogart. With George Burns, Ted Wass, Ron Silver, Roxanne Hart. George Burns returns as God - and as Satan. They battle over the soul of a young rock star who is willing to sell it to the devil.
